Description
We are Walmart
We help people around the world save money and live better -- anytime and anywhere -- in retail stores, online and through their mobile devices. Each week, more than 220 million customers and members visit our 11,096 stores under 69 banners in 27 countries and e-commerce websites in 10 countries. With last fiscal revenues of approximately $473 billion, we employ 2.2 million employees worldwide.
@ Walmart Labs in Bangalore, we enable an ecosystem, wherein our customers can “save money so they can live better”, by using technology for the charter of building brand new platforms and services on latest technology stack to support both our e-commerce and stores businesses worldwide
The charter for the Global Back Office Solutions team is to deliver on the goal of Everyday Low Cost (EDLC) by driving efficiency in all the back office processes, through technology. Combining Technologists with Business Analysts and data experts, we build and deploy solutions that support billions of transactions every month
Role Description
The role is of a Java Developer who is motivated to actively contribute to the design and development of new features. The role is expected to contribute and support in delivering technical solutions for various problems.
Your Responsibility
- Involvement in the development and documentation of product features
- Build, test and deploy cutting edge solutions at scale, impacting associates of Walmart worldwide.
- Interact with Walmart engineering teams across geographies to leverage expertise and contribute to the tech community.
- Be involved in the successful implementation by applying technical skills, to design and build enhanced processes and technical solutions in support of strategic initiatives.
- Work closely with the Tech Leads/Architects and cross functional teams and follow established practices for the delivery of solutions meeting QCD (Quality, Cost & Delivery) within the established architectural guidelines.
- Interact closely for requirements with Business owners and technical teams both within India and across the globe.
Your Qualifications
- B.Tech. / B.E. / M.Tech. / M.S. in Computer Science
- 1+ years of experience in design and development of highly -scalable applications and platform development in product based companies or R&D divisions.
- Strong computer science fundamentals: data structures, algorithms, design patterns.
- 1+ years of hands-On experience in web technologies like React JS, Redux, Java script, HTML/CSS
- Knowledge using these technologies - NodeJs
- Knowledge on Restful web services
- Knowledge on any unit testing
- Working knowledge of SQL database technologies
- Knowledge on cloud platforms like Microsoft Azure would be a plus
- Knowledge on CI/CD development environments/tools: Git, Maven, Jenkins, Azure DevOps would be a plus
- Awareness of Agile (Scrum) methodologies would be a plus
- Hands on development skills to prototype technical solutions.
- Ability to adapt to change quickly, willingness to learn new and emerging technologies
- Excellent debugging and problem solving capability
- Good communication and interpersonal
- Motivated team player who goes over and above what is asked
- Attitude to thrive in a fun, fast-paced start-up like environment
Our Ideal Candidate
You have a deep interest and passion for technology. You love owning new responsibilities and enjoy working with people who will keep challenging you at every stage. You have strong problem solving, analytic, decision-making and excellent communication with interpersonal skills. You are self-driven and motivated with entrepreneurial passion and desire to work in a fast -paced, results- driven agile environment with varied responsibilities. You have a passion to mentor and drive technical associates to deliver quality products in an agile environment. You have a flair to setup new process and bring in an innovative mindset to drive the team.
Skills Required
Java Full Stack
Location
Chennai, Tamil Nadu, India
Education/Qualification
BE
Designation
Software Engineer III